this post was submitted on 24 Dec 2021
20 points (100.0% liked)

Privacy

31918 readers
1012 users here now

A place to discuss privacy and freedom in the digital world.

Privacy has become a very important issue in modern society, with companies and governments constantly abusing their power, more and more people are waking up to the importance of digital privacy.

In this community everyone is welcome to post links and discuss topics related to privacy.

Some Rules

Related communities

Chat rooms

much thanks to @gary_host_laptop for the logo design :)

founded 5 years ago
MODERATORS
 

I heard about that you can check via a hash code if the Signal Open Source Code the same code like the App Store Code is this true, have some one more informatons about this ?

you are viewing a single comment's thread
view the rest of the comments
[–] riccardo@lemmy.ml 7 points 2 years ago* (last edited 2 years ago) (2 children)

The Android app allows reproducible builds since 2016:

As of our latest Android release, Signal builds are reproducible. Reproducible builds help to verify that the source code in our GitHub repository is the exact source code used to build the compiled Signal APK being distributed through Google Play.

Anyway:

Remaining Work

Reproducible builds for Java are simple, but the Signal Android codebase includes some native shared libraries that we employ for voice calls (WebRTC, etc). At the time this native code was added, there was no Gradle NDK support yet, so the shared libraries aren’t compiled with the project build.

Getting the Gradle NDK support set up and making its output reproducible will likely be more difficult.

No idea if progress has been made about native shared libraries, but there are probably more info about this in their reproducible builds readme

I don't think this is available for the iOS app (there is an open issue on GitHub about this)

[–] v162@lemmy.ml 1 points 2 years ago

ohh nice to see there have something like this. thx for the info :)